Job Description

The Materials Handler I assists in the day-to-day activities relating to inventory control functions supporting pharmaceutical fill/finish operations. The main responsibility of this position is to assist with all aspects of logistics such as receiving, shipping, data entry, inventory control, labeling and maintaining all associated cGMP documentation as needed. Additional responsibilities include creating and updating log sheets and inventory cards, shipping activities, and all inventory movement functions including updating databases, labeling and maintaining all associated cGMP documentation.
